#m-subnav h2 span {background:url(../img/headers/sprite-subnav.png) 0 -48px no-repeat;}
#m-page-header h2.ranking-freeleague-title {background:url(http://nxcache.nexon.net/atlantica/img/headers/sprite-ranking.png ) no-repeat 0 0;}
#m-page-header h2.ranking-search {background:url(http://nxcache.nexon.net/atlantica/img/headers/sprite-ranking.png) no-repeat 0 -26px;}
#m-page{padding:10px 27px 40px 23px}
#nav-ranking {padding:0 0 0 23px;width:553px;height:31px;background:url(../img/news/bg-nav-news.png) no-repeat;float:left;clear:both;margin:0 0 12px 0;}	
#nav-ranking li{float:left;height:29px;margin:0 5px; padding-left:10px;text-transform:uppercase;font-weight:bold;font-size:13px;text-align:center;line-height:32px}
#nav-ranking li a{color:#5673B4;display:block; text-decoration:none;padding-right:10px}
#nav-ranking li:hover, #nav-ranking li.active{background:url(../img/news/bg-nav-news-link.png) no-repeat 0 2px;}
#nav-ranking li:hover a,#nav-ranking li.active a{background:url(../img/news/bg-nav-news-link.png) no-repeat 100% 2px;color:#b2ceee}
#subnav-ranking{float:left;height:25px;background:#000;width:576px;margin:-17px 0 20px 0;}
	#subnav-ranking li{float:left;}
	#subnav-ranking a{color:#5272bb;line-height:22px}
		#subnav-ranking a:hover, #subnav-ranking a.active{color:#a1b5cd;text-decoration:none}
#subnav-ranking.server li{margin-left:20px}
	#subnav-ranking.server li+li, #subnav-ranking.supplies li+li{margin-left:25px}
#subnav-ranking li label{color:#5673b4;float:left;line-height:22px;padding-left:5px}
#subnav-ranking li input{float:left;margin-top:5px}

/*TOP 3 PLAYER*/

.top-players {display:block;padding:30px 10px 10px 0;display:block;clear:both;float:left}
.top-players li{float:left}
.medal-rank{background:url(../img/rankings/medal.png) no-repeat;width:84px;height:78px;display:block;margin-right:10px}
	.medal-rank.second{background-position:-84px 0}
	.medal-rank.third{background-position:-168px 0}
.top-players-list {border:1px solid #282828;clear:both;}
.server-name {-moz-border-radius: 3px 3px 3px 3px;background:#000;border: 1px solid #313131;float: left;font-size: 10px;padding: 0 4px;text-align: center;text-transform: uppercase;line-height:18px;width: 68px;color:#805417;margin:0 10px 8px 0;}
.player-tag {color:#baac7b;}

.top-players thead th {background:#000;font-weight:normal;}
.top-players thead th, .top-players tbody td {border-right:1px solid #282828;text-align:center;}
.top-players tbody td{color:#5673b4;}

/*PLAYER SEARCH */
#player-search{width:175px;height:22px;border:solid 1px #2d2f32;float:right;margin:0 10px 10px 0; margin:25px 25px 10px;}
	#player-search input[type="text"]{float:left;width:163;height:22px;padding-left:9px;background:#040404;color:#6c7f91;}
	#player-search input[type="submit"]{float:left;width:23px;height:22px;background:url(../img/news/btn-news-search.png) no-repeat;text-indent:-9999px;cursor:pointer;}
	
/*SERVER SEARCH*/
.server {color:#6c7f91;float:right;margin:25px 0 10px;font-size:13px;}
.server select{color:#6c7f91;background:#000;width:110px;border:solid 1px #2d2f31; height:22px;text-align:left;margin-left:5px;}
	
/*REST OF PLAYER RANKING*/
.player-list {clear:both; font-size: 13px; width: 576px;border-bottom:#000000 solid 1px;margin:28px 0 20px;float:left}
	.player-list thead {background:#000; height: 27px; text-align:center;}
	.player-list tbody {text-align:center;}
	.player-list td {padding:10px 0 5px 0;}
	.player-list a:hover {color:#b2ceee;text-decoration:none}
	td .server-name {margin:0}

/*PAGER TAGS*/
.s-pager {clear:both; margin-top:40px;text-align:center;color:#b2ceee;}
.s-pager li {display:inline; margin: 0 5px;font-weight:bold;}
.s-pager li a{color:#b2ceee;font-weight:normal;}
.s-pager li a:hover {color:#b2ceee;text-decoration:none;}

/*SEARCH PAGE*/
.search-wrap{display:block;background:#212121; height:40px;float:left;height:20px;margin:3px 0 40px 0px;width:550px;padding:10px 10px 15px 10px;}
.search-title {color:#e19533;font-size:18px; font-weight:normal;clear:both;margin:40px 0 5px 10px;clear:both;}
.search-server {color:#6c7f91;font-size:13px;float:left;margin:2px 0 0 85px;}
.search-server select{color:#6c7f91;background:#000;width:110px;border:solid 1px #2d2f31; height:22px;text-align:left;margin-left:5px;;padding:0 0 0 3px;}
#server-search{width:300px;height:20px;display:block;float:left;margin:1px 0 5px 0;}
	#server-search-buttons input.search-player[type="submit"]{background:url(../img/news/btn-news-search.png) no-repeat;float:left;width:23px;height:22px;text-indent:-9999px;cursor:pointer;;border:solid 1px #2d2f32}
	#server-search-buttons input[type="text"]{float:left;width:157;height:22px;padding-left:9px;background:#040404;color:#6c7f91;;border:solid 1px #2d2f32;margin-left:10px;}
	#server-search-buttons input.search-rank[type="submit"]{background:url(../img/btn/btn-rank-search.png) no-repeat;float:left;width:89px;height:24px;cursor:pointer;margin:0 0 5px 10px;text-indent:-9999px;}
.search-hover{color:#b2ceee;background:#000;}
.search-list {clear:both; font-size: 13px; width: 576px;border-bottom:#000000 solid 1px;padding-bottom:20px;}
	.search-list thead {background:#000; height: 27px; text-align:center;}
	.search-list tbody {text-align:center;}
	.player-list td {padding:10px 0 5px 0;}
	.first-row{height:45px;}





